Abstract

We investigate the unextendible maximally entangled bases (UMEBs) in Cd <g> Cd and present a 30-number UMEB construction in C6 C6. For the higher-dimensional case, we show that for a given A-number UMEB in Cd Cd, there is an N-number, N = (qd)² - (d² - N), UMEB in € N Cqd for any q € N. As an example, for C 12n C12n systems, we show that there are at least two sets of UMEBs which are not equivalent. [ABSTRACT FROM AUTHOR]
